The Eaton Miniature Circuit Breaker is meticulously designed to ensure robust protection in electrical circuits. Engineered to manage a rated operational current of 63 A, this device stands out for its precise D characteristic curve, making it ideal for safeguarding thermal overloads and short-circuits efficiently. With a compact design, it features a single-pole configuration, ensuring it fits seamlessly into various switchgear systems. Crafted with rigorous adherence to international safety standards and compatibility with diverse applications, this circuit breaker supports both AC voltage ratings up to 415 V and includes provisions for different conductor cross-sections. Its certifications, including UL and CSA approval, along with compliance with the IEC/EN 60898 standards, affirm its reliability and safety in critical electrical installations, enhancing reliability and peace of mind for professionals in the field.
